What this does well:This set is very colorful and fun. It's reasonably easy to assemble, and full of hours of fun for kids. The loops come in 12 colors, which is a great and wide range.The bracelet braiding frame is a smart idea and a good way to teach knot tying by providing tension. Again, lots of colorful cords make it a fun starter kit.What this set isn't:I've done a lot of weaving on potholder looms. The standard old style looms are about 6 inches square and made of metal. They're very basic and inexpensive, and you can weave with bulky yarns on them as well as potholder loops. This loom is much larger (9.5 in), but actually has the same number of pegs (18 on each side) as the traditional looms, so you end up with a potholder that is the same size once it is off the loom.There is no weaving hook included, so you have to manually weave the loops. Again, good for keeping kids hands busy.The loops are synthetic and small, so the potholders aren't as good for blocking heat as the larger cotton loops available elsewhere.On the whole, I'd recommend this kit as a colorful activity for kids who like to work with their hands and a very beginner introduction to weaving and knotting.

This functions as either a pot holder loom or a bracelet making loom, but not both at once. You have to assemble the loom yourself, which is not super difficult except getting the pegs properly installed takes some dexterity and can be just a little tricky. You will have to help younger kids with this step. The loom for potholders is a lot larger than the standard plastic or metal ones, so it's a little bit harder to keep the loops from snapping off during the removal process. This does come with plenty materials to get started. The loops are decent quality nylon, and there is a fair bit of cord to start making bracelets. I like that there is a little mesh tote included to store all of the supplies in. It's small, but it holds the loops and cord supplies. There is an instruction guide included that can help with learning to do the basics, but kids will likely still need help to get going.

The Vividlife Weaving Loom Kit is perfect for my daughter to have fun weaving creations like so many of us and others have done. This kit comes with a pretty blue loom that the child puts together and completes with pretty pink nails. It comes with a handy storage bag to hold the looms, a crochet needle, a plastic needle, 12 bungee cords and 12 cartoon buckles, 16 bracelet strings, 12 stickers, and 288 colorful loops in 12 bright colors. Two instruction booklets are also included. Along with a long white string of yarn for some reason. The instructions for the bracelets do look quite “busy” for a child though and may frustrate some kids without a parent to guide them.
